Morvold Fantasy Art Gallery Update - CLERICS & PALADINS!

In January 2024, I began an initiative to create a Fantasy Art Gallery comprised of 100% human-made artwork to begin populating a gallery that could be used by YOU (DM's and Players) to find inspiration and use for their personal, home games.

In January, I ended up commissioning about 32 artists for this month's collection, who were given the same theme of - "Clerics & Paladins".

The permanent website for these is being developed, but until that resource is available, I am going to be keeping the images here for everyone to be able to view and access.

LICENSING NOTE

All image rights are owned by the individual artist and I have licensed these images to be used in a Fantasy Art Gallery that can be used by anyone for their own personal and private games.

They cannot be used commercially, unless you want to contact the artist and discuss licensing independently.

My plan is to do a new round each month and slowly build out a large repository of fantasy art for people to use that will encourage and support human artists vs. AI art. Even though I use AI images for concept work, I still feel very strongly that human artists should be kept in the loop and used/supported, especially for commercial work.
